Description

The purpose of this book is to explain why, after the occurrence of unconstitutional changes of government, a period of transition is necessary. The author sustains the view that periods of transition present opportunities to not only set up the structural foundations of the soul of the nation, but also to establish solid democratic institutions and durable peace. He believes that the success of a democratic transition is founded on the way transitional institutions are organised, as well as on their commitment to peace and to democratic values. Many instances are based in african countries.

PREFACE
"To be prepared to have hope in what does not deceive, first one must despair in that which deceives."  Georges Bernanos
Democratic awareness is a historical emergence. The capacity to generate or regenerate democracy is often the result of a crisis. Despite antagonisms and the oppositions between times of peace and times of war, by a fragile miracle, the periods of transition contribute to the connection of the possible to the impossible. Antonio BAMBISSA speaks from experience. He was born in Mozambique, in the heart of the great African continent, in the southern zone of the southeast that borders the great lakes of Africa and interacts with the Indian Ocean. As a diplomat, he has had the time to observe and analyse the conflicts across his continent. He has asked himself questions with the mindset of both a field worker and a researcher, on what can tilt political situations in the direction of destruction or of creation. Here he suggests, with the acuity of an expert in political sciences, the scrutinisation of the very heart of political fragility where there is oscillation between the possible and impossible. He ventures with perceptiveness to adopt an unusual angle of attack. The analysis that he delivers here is therefore not classical and involves a certain amount of erudition. A former auditor at the Centre for Diplomatic and Strategic Studies in Paris, he seeks in an international context the geometric locus of contributing factors favouring the emergence of peace.
